obverse-description Charles Barber's depiction of Liberty is portrayed facing right with UNITED STATES OF AMERICA around the periphery and the date centered at the bottom.

reverse-description ONE DIME is centered in the middle of the reverse surrounded by a wreath tied by a bow at the bottom. Mint mark, if any, appears below the bow at the bottom.
